CHURCH CLERKS, TREASURERS ENCOURAGED TO EMBRACE ACMS

Writer's picture: J. MaclayJ. Maclay


South Malawi Conference (SMC) of the Seventh-day Adventist Church's Chief Financial Officer, Elder Davie Chipungu has encouraged Church Clerks and Treasurers to effectively use the Adventist Church Management Systems to keep Christian membership register and financial records.


Elder Chipungu made the appeal on 1st June 2024 at Balaka Stadium during the launch of the 'Community Service Week'.


"The system must be used accordingly because it makes updating of church records very easy therefore church elders , clerks and treasurers should work together in managing the system," he explained.


He further said that the Adventist Church Management System is a worldwide system which was introduced to Malawi Union Conference in 2010.

Welcome to Central Malawi Conference of the Seventh-day Adventist Church in Malawi!

 

On behalf of the 118,712 plus Seventh-day Adventists who comprise Central Malawi Conference of the Seventh-day Adventist Church in Malawi, I congratulate you for visiting our website. We are here to serve you. Central Malawi Conference started out as a mission field in 1964 and was first headquartered at Dedza Boma some 99 kilometers from Lilongwe and about 221 kilometers from Blantyre off the M1 road in Malawi.  Read More
